An exploration of everything the countryside means to us from a hundred years of the Telegraphs archive. The Telegraph is as its former editor Max Hastings identified more than any other national broadsheet the newspaper of the countryside which over the years has been written about in its pages by such distinguished writers as J.H.B. Peel John Betjeman & W.F. Deedes alongside eminent modern naturalists like Richard Mabey & even unlikely proponents of the rural life like Boris Johnson. This anthology is no bland celebration of bucolic idyll but rather an exploration of everything that the countryside represents to the British. For some it means the reintroduction of long-lost wildlife such as the red kite or ancient crafts like thatching. For others it means jouncing along a green lane in a four-wheel-drive Range Rover. To the Prince of Wales his new town of Poundbury is the countryside while subjects as diverse as crop circles second homes Mad Cow Disease & polytunnels are all flashpoints in the modern debate about what & who the countryside is for. Hugely varied by turns funny & provocative this is an essential exploration of a central aspect of our national identity. ...

Heidi is a much loved Puffin Classic by Johanna Spyri. Little Heidi goes to live with her grandfather in his lonely hut high in the Alps & she quickly learns to love her new life. But her strict aunt decides to send her away again to live in the town. Heidi cannot bear being away from the mountains & is determined to return to the happiness of life with her grandfather. With a delightfully nostalgic introduction by award-winning author Eva Ibbotson. Johanna Spyri (1827-1902) was born in Switzerland in the village of Hirzel which has magnificent views of the Alps. She wrote almost fifty books but it was Heidi who brought her great fame. Jan Francis reads Johanna Spyris classic tale of the adventures of a little Swiss girl. Ever since her mother died Heidi has been looked after by her aunt Dete. But now Dete is moving to Frankfurt & Heidi must go & live with her grandfather in a hut high up in the Swiss mountains. There she meets Peter the goatherd & his blind grandmother & the three become great friends. Heidi loves her new carefree life
- but then her aunt returns to take her away from everyone she loves. Will she ever come back to the mountains again?
